Output a63aca1161905ba5325b7ee4ffd2f75cf73c91a83a669decaf0c110f28cb229a:21

value
113474
script pubkey
OP_0 OP_PUSHBYTES_20 3ecb3a883b4975a3e9014e47b3cf21de11212f9c
address
bc1q8m9n4zpmf96686gpferm8nepmcgjztuu7x7945
transaction
a63aca1161905ba5325b7ee4ffd2f75cf73c91a83a669decaf0c110f28cb229a
spent
true